Output dfaa27da3890aee9848644916ddacfba2679b858b28c83d750883f3f65082259:17

value
3864000
script pubkey
OP_0 OP_PUSHBYTES_20 5614ac8b0f17dc44cab53f8d58f0578082b06a70
address
ltc1q2c22ezc0zlwyfj4487x43uzhszptq6nshp6u64
transaction
dfaa27da3890aee9848644916ddacfba2679b858b28c83d750883f3f65082259
spent
false